Лимиттік тапсырыс жасау
post
https://api.cryptomus.com/v2/user-api/convert/limit
Өтініш
Сұрау параметрлері
Есім | Параметр түрі | Анықтама |
---|---|---|
from* | stringmax:10 | Ауыстыру валютасы (көрініс) |
to* | stringmax:10 | Ауыстыру валютасы (мақсат) |
amount* | string | Ауыстыру үшін сома (бастапқы валютада)methods.If there are pennies in the amount |
price* | string | Ауыстыру бағасыmethods.If there are pennies in the amount |
Параметр түрі
stringmax:10Анықтама
Ауыстыру валютасы (көрініс)Параметр түрі
stringmax:10Анықтама
Ауыстыру валютасы (мақсат)Параметр түрі
stringАнықтама
Ауыстыру үшін сома (бастапқы валютада)methods.If there are pennies in the amountПараметр түрі
stringАнықтама
Ауыстыру бағасыmethods.If there are pennies in the amount
* - Міндетті параметр
Мысал сұрау
curl https://api.cryptomus.com/v2/user-api/convert/limit \
-X POST \
-H 'userId: 8b03432e-385b-4670-8d06-064591096795' \
-H 'sign: fe99035f86fa436181717b302b95bacff1' \
-H 'Content-Type: application/json' \
-d '{
"from": "BTC",
"to": "USDT",
"amount": "0.0001",
"price": "70000"
}'
ЕліктеуЖауап
Жауап параметрлері
Есім | Анықтама |
---|---|
order_id | Ауыстыру ID |
convert_amount_from | Ауыстыру сомасы (бастапқы) |
convert_amount_to | Ауыстыру сомасы (мақсат) |
executed_amount_to | Орындалған сома (мақсат) |
executed_amount_from | Орындалған сома (бастапқы) |
convert_currency_from | Ауыстыру валютасы (бастапқы) |
convert_currency_to | Ауыстыру валютасы (мақсат) |
type | Түрлерді санауҚол жетімді опциялар:• market• limit |
status | Жағдайларды санауҚол жетімді опциялар:• active• completed• partially_completed• cancelled• expired• failed |
created_at | Жасалу күні мен уақыты |
current_rate | Ағымдағы курс |
limit | Шек мәні (тек шек түрінде) |
expires_at | Шектің аяқталу күні мен уақыты |
completed_at | Тапсырыс орындалған күні мен уақыты (тек тапсырыс орындалған жағдайда) |
Анықтама
Ауыстыру IDАнықтама
Ауыстыру сомасы (бастапқы)Анықтама
Ауыстыру сомасы (мақсат)Анықтама
Орындалған сома (мақсат)Анықтама
Орындалған сома (бастапқы)Анықтама
Ауыстыру валютасы (бастапқы)Анықтама
Ауыстыру валютасы (мақсат)Анықтама
Түрлерді санауҚол жетімді опциялар:- market- limitАнықтама
Жағдайларды санауҚол жетімді опциялар:- active- completed- partially_completed- cancelled- expired- failedАнықтама
Жасалу күні мен уақытыАнықтама
Ағымдағы курсАнықтама
Шек мәні (тек шек түрінде)Анықтама
Шектің аяқталу күні мен уақытыАнықтама
Тапсырыс орындалған күні мен уақыты (тек тапсырыс орындалған жағдайда)
Жауаптың мысалы
1{
2 "state": 0,
3 "result": {
4 "order_id": "2d9bf426-98ef-448b-84c2-03cc1ec78feb",
5 "convert_amount_from": "10.000",
6 "convert_amount_to": "3.000",
7 "executed_amount_from": null,
8 "executed_amount_to": null,
9 "convert_currency_from": "USDT",
10 "convert_currency_to": "XMR",
11 "type": "market",
12 "status": "completed",
13 "created_at": "2024-07-11 , 18:06:04",
14 "current_rate": "100",
15 "completed_at": "2024-07-11 , 18:06:04"
16 }
17}
Еліктеу